Continuous Development Will Change Organizations as Much as Agile Did

Harvard Business Review

The methodology is Continuous Development, which, like agile, began as a software development methodology. Rather than improving software in one large batch, updates are made continuously, piece-by-piece, enabling software code to be delivered to customers as soon as it is completed and tested.
